Historic Environment Record entry

Listed building

A mid-19th century farm group which contributes to the rural, roadside setting in the valley and relates to the other historic buildings of Le Ponterrin nearby. The farm buildings retain their external historic character. The farm house was altered and extended in the 1930s by architect AB Grayson, who added a full-height bow window to the south elevation and a gable entrance with classical portico. The clients were Captain McCammon and his wife, who later commissioned Les Lumieres with her next husband, Tony Huelin.
